    Intuit Inc. is a multinational business software company that specializes in financial software, such as TurboTax, QuickBooks, and Credit Karma. It was founded in 1983 by Scott Cook and Tom Proulx, and has faced legal issues over its tax preparation products.

    QuickBooks is a popular accounting software package for small and medium-sized businesses, developed and marketed by Intuit since 1992. It offers on-premises and cloud-based versions, as well as industry-specific and international variants, with features such as payroll, billing, banking, and tax calculation.

    Credit Karma is a subsidiary of Intuit that offers free credit scores, reports, monitoring and tools, as well as tax preparation and unclaimed money services. Founded in 2007, it operates in the US, Canada and the UK and earns revenue from targeted advertisements for financial products.
